Changelog — VelvetGrid renderer 3.1. Heads up, newcomers: we changed the defaults for the Orpington Hall seat maps. Curved rows now render with smoothing on, and the zoom floor went from 0.5 to 0.75 because tiny seats were unclickable on phones. Old configs still work but will warn. The new default configuration block ships as follows.

config for kafof-bawef:
holath:
  log_level: debug
  metrics_host: metrics.holath.qorvelsys.internal
  pin: 2191
  pool_size: 32

Audience: Sales Leads

This page summarises the planned overhaul of the Lanterhill Rewards programme. The current points model will be retired in favour of milestone-based credits, which early modelling by the Darnwick team suggests will lift repeat purchase rates by 9–12%. Migration of existing balances happens in two waves, with legacy tiers honoured for six months. Sales leads should prepare talking points for top accounts but hold all external messaging. The strategic intent driving this overhaul is recorded in the note below.

board note of baweg-bawig: Project Tamath slips by six weeks because of the audit delay.

Minutes — Management Meeting, Fourth Floor Room

Present: leadership team of Quillarch Trading. Main item: currency hedging. After some back-and-forth, the group agreed to hedge roughly sixty percent of next year's expected Veldmark exposure using forward contracts. Renn will line up quotes; decision to be revisited quarterly. The thinking behind the ratio is summarized confidentially below.

board note of kafog-bajep: Briathek Partners is in early talks to buy Aldaelek Group for about $47.1 million. The Ulaath launch date is September 4, and nothing goes to the press before then.

Changelog — WaveGlint 4.2

The audio waveform preview now defaults to downsampled peaks instead of full-resolution rendering. This cuts preview generation time for long uploads and reduces memory on shared workers. Customers who relied on the old behavior can re-enable it per workspace. The new defaults shipped to all regions are listed below.

deployment values, kajep-kageg:
[praix]
host = praix.paliqcorp.corp
user = praix_svc
database = praix_prod